假设您正在制作德州扑克服务器.我们有一个大堂和多个房间,在这些房间里进行游戏.你在什么级别分开房间?
最初我以为我会为大厅里的每个房间生成一个节点实例.主要的好处是,如果游戏崩溃,它肯定会孤立地这样做.
当我意识到聊天服务器通常作为管理多个房间的单个守护进程运行时,我对这种方法失去了信心.对于大堂的每个房间都需要一个单独的监听端口似乎很难看.我认为跨房间管理身份也变得更容易 - 例如,如果玩家改名.
有什么想法吗?"多路复用"单个节点服务器来管理多个游戏室会话是否有意义?
我有一个对象,它在一个单独的线程中向服务器发出一些http请求.当返回响应时,我调用一个监听器,让我的活动知道操作已经完成.
问题是:如果线程正在运行且活动暂停,我会收到android.view.WindowManager$BadTokenException: Unable to add window -- token android.os.BinderProxy@4069ef80 is not valid; is your activity running?错误.
是否有可能检测到活动是否暂停?谢谢.
我有一个程序(主应用程序,由遗留代码组成),它使用一个库.遗憾的是,主应用程序和库都使用了一个名为(具有相同名称和相同属性)的类Softwares.SoftwareXSD.当我使用里面定义的类时Softwares.SoftwareXSD,主程序抱怨模棱两可.但是,Visual Studio表示,通过在类名下显示绿色下划线,可以在复制品中进行选择.我相信这不是一个好方法.
这有什么问题吗?这种情况的最佳解决方法是什么?
问题是XSD中的某些类特定于主应用程序,而某些类特定于库,但这些类使用引用相互链接.
我正在尝试为google appengine应用程序设置静态登录页面.但是,当我访问网站的根目录时,我得到404.它在本地工作正常只是在我部署它时不起作用.app.html页面正常工作,因此它的登录页面无效.
这是来自app.yaml的东西
handlers:
- url: /rest/.*
script: main.py
login: required
- url: /js
static_dir: static/js
- url: /
static_files: static\index.html
upload: static\index.html
- url: /app.html
static_files: static/app.html
upload: static/app.html
login: required
- url: /.*
script: main.py
Run Code Online (Sandbox Code Playgroud) 有没有办法用样式设置textarea的部分文本。例如,如果我有一个具有此值的文本区域:
Hi, how are you
我想要这个:
嗨,你好吗
以粗体设置我想要的单词,而不是在文本区域中写入的所有值。我想用 jQuery 做它,也许是一个插件或其他东西。
我的文本区域:
<textarea id="txtMessageFields" cols="20" rows="2"></textarea>
Run Code Online (Sandbox Code Playgroud) 我正在尝试使元组列表以特定方式存储一些信息.比如scotland属于uk,england属于uk等等.然后把两个字符串作为参数(String -> String -> Bool)来做类似的东西:
Main> owns "china" "beijing"
True
Main> owns "uk" "beijing"
False
Run Code Online (Sandbox Code Playgroud)
这是我的代码:
lst = [("uk","scotland"),("uk","england"),("uk","wales"),("china","beijing"),("china","hongkong"),("china","shanghai")]
owns :: String -> String -> Bool
owns a b = [n|(a,b) <- lst, (n == a)] && [m|(a,b) <- lst, (m==b]
Run Code Online (Sandbox Code Playgroud)
谢谢你的帮助.
我有一个ajaxcheck盒子.选中后,它会向服务器发回AJAX请求,获取数据并修改当前数据ul.
$('#event_filters').change(function() {
//#$('spinner').show();
$.ajax({
url: "/search/filters.json?search=13",
success: function(data){
$("#results").children('li').each(function(){
$(this).text('blah');
});
alert('came here'+data);
//how to modify current ul to remove old li's and add new ones
},
});
});
Run Code Online (Sandbox Code Playgroud)
我在其他一些网站上看到了这个功能,我相信它们会添加动画以及删除旧li并添加新功能的过渡看起来非常顺利.
我正在开发一个网站,我决定使用Facebook评论来提供可评论的行为.但不幸的是,我遇到了一些问题.
在尝试自定义新闻页面的外观时,例如.http://buchman.pcspace.pl/aktualnosci/ept-snowfest-podsumowanie-czwartego-dnia.html,我无法应用CSS来查看:所有内容都在HTML源代码中正确显示,但不会更改视图.
怎么了?